27,000 Oregonians lose unemployment insurance pay
The Bush Administration, which is sitting on $20 billion in federal UI funds, has declined to support any new extensions of the federal jobless benefits that expired in December.

U.S. judge upholds ban on petition pay per signature
A federal judge ruled Feb. 11 that the ban on per-signature payments to initiative and referendum petitioners, passed by the voters as Measure 26 in the 2002 general election, was needed “to protect the integrity of the electoral process and to restore the public’s confidence in its government.”

UFCW endorses Adams for Portland City Council post
Adams, a former aide to Mayor Vera Katz, is running for the council seat being vacated by Jim Francesconi. Francesconi is leaving the post to run for mayor. Katz is not seeking re-election.
